Technical Specifications
Side-by-side comparison of Xeon Silver 4123 and Xeon W-2135

Xeon Silver 4123
The Xeon Silver 4123 is manufactured by Intel. It was released in 2015-01-01. It features 8 cores and 16 threads. Base frequency is 3 GHz, with boost up to 3.2 GHz. L3 cache: 11 MB. Built on 14 nm process technology. Socket: LGA3647. Thermal design power (TDP): 105 Watt. Memory support: DDR4-2400. Passmark benchmark score: 14,405 points. Launch price was $800.

Xeon W-2135
The Xeon W-2135 is manufactured by Intel. It was released in 29 August 2017 (8 years ago). It is based on the Skylake (server) (2017−2018) architecture. It features 6 cores and 12 threads. Base frequency is 3.7 GHz, with boost up to 4.5 GHz. L3 cache: 8.25 MB (total). L2 cache: 1 MB (per core). Built on 14 nm process technology. Socket: LGA2066. Thermal design power (TDP): 140 Watt. Memory support: DDR4-1600, DDR4-1866, DDR4-2133, DDR4-2400, DDR4-2666. Passmark benchmark score: 14,396 points. Launch price was $835.
Processing Power
The Xeon Silver 4123 packs 8 cores / 16 threads, while the Xeon W-2135 offers 6 cores / 12 threads — the Xeon Silver 4123 has 2 more cores. Boost clocks reach 3.2 GHz on the Xeon Silver 4123 versus 4.5 GHz on the Xeon W-2135 — a 33.8% clock advantage for the Xeon W-2135 (base: 3 GHz vs 3.7 GHz). The Xeon W-2135 is built on the Skylake (server) (2017−2018) architecture. In PassMark, the Xeon Silver 4123 scores 14,405 against the Xeon W-2135's 14,396 — a 0.1% lead for the Xeon Silver 4123. L3 cache: 11 MB on the Xeon Silver 4123 vs 8.25 MB (total) on the Xeon W-2135.

Memory & Platform
The Xeon Silver 4123 uses the LGA3647 socket (PCIe 3.0), while the Xeon W-2135 uses LGA2066 (PCIe 3.0) — making them incompatible on the same motherboard.
